Answer:

f(0)=0

Explanation:

The number in the parenthesis in a function are what you substitute for x, so do that for the problem:

f(x)=(1/2)(x) --> f(0)=(1/2)(0)

Then solve for f(0) by simplifying the other side of the equation:

f(0)=0
